Diplomatic Intelligence Brief — 19 Feb 2026
1) Executive Summary
- UK consolidates forward posture: opens a British Embassy Office in Lviv, presents the UK–Australia nuclear-powered submarine agreement to Parliament, and presses Russia at the OSCE on risk reduction.
- Sudan escalates as a priority: UK issues a statement on the UN Fact-Finding Mission report on El Fasher; a joint ministerial statement condemns intensified drone and aerial attacks on civilians and humanitarian operations; France engages the UN humanitarian lead.
- UK rearticulates its Middle East line at the UN Security Council, framing a two-state solution within a broader regional normalization and integration context.
- UK counter-terrorism sanctions machinery updated; monitor for new designations/revocations impacting financial exposure.

2) Key Developments (by theatre/topic)
- Sudan/Darfur
- UK Foreign Secretary issued a statement on the UN Fact-Finding Mission report on El Fasher (Item 6).
- Joint ministerial statement (France-hosted) expresses grave concern over continued unlawful attacks, citing a severe escalation in drone and aerial strikes affecting displaced civilians, health facilities, food convoys, and areas near humanitarian compounds across Kordofan and Darfur (Item 9).
-
French Foreign Minister spoke with the UN’s Emergency Relief Coordinator, emphasizing international humanitarian law and protection of civilians (Item 10).
-
Middle East
-
UK statement at the UN Security Council underscores that a two-state solution can unlock normalization, regional integration, and peaceful coexistence (Item 7).
-
Ukraine/Russia/Europe
- UK formally opens a British Embassy Office in Lviv, expanding its diplomatic footprint in Ukraine (Item 16).
- At the OSCE, the UK calls on Russia to engage in credible risk management and to set out concrete steps to reduce escalation risks and prevent miscalculation (Item 14).

Indo-Pacific / AUKUS
-
The UK–Australia Nuclear-Powered Submarine Partnership and Collaboration Agreement was presented to Parliament (TS No. 7/2026) (Item 15).
-
Libya
-
UK reiterates strong support for UNSMIL and an inclusive political process at the UN Security Council (Item 11).
-
Sanctions / Counter-terrorism
-
UK’s counter-terrorism designations and sanctions notices page updated; the page lists designated persons and changes to the UK Sanctions List (Item 1).
-
Governance / Digital
- France launches an international call for scientific contributions on risks to minors from generative AI, announced in New Delhi (Item 17).
